Z-Rec™ Silicon Carbide Schottky Diodes, Wolfspeed


A range of Wolfspeed SiC (Silicon Carbide) Schottky diodes offering significant improvements over standard Schottky barrier diodes. SiC diodes provide a much higher breakdown field strength and greater thermal conductivity coupled with a significant reduction in power-loss at high switching frequencies. Sic diodes are the perfect choice in high efficiency, high-voltage applications such as switch-mode power supplies and high-speed inverters.

• 600, 650, 1200 and 1700 Voltage ratings

• Zero reverse recovery current and forward recovery voltage

• Temperature-independent switching behaviour

• Extremely fast switching times with minimal losses

• Positive temperature coefficient forward voltage

• Devices can be paralleled without thermal runaway

• Reduction in heatsink requirements

• Optimized for PFC boost diode applications
